Head to head by decade
| Decade | Ecuador | Jordan |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1970s | 10.8% | 10.0% | 0.7% | Ecuador |
| 1990s | 4.6% | 0.9% | 3.6% | Ecuador |
| 2000s | 3.4% | 2.5% | 0.9% | Ecuador |
| 2010s | 2.2% | 1.9% | 0.3% | Ecuador |
| 2020s | 1.1% | 0.8% | 0.3% | Ecuador |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
